The national median salary for Legal Assistants in 2026 is $59,358, with entry-level positions averaging $42,738 and senior roles reaching $84,289. But those numbers flatten a reality with enormous geographic variation — Sunnyvale pays a median of $108,120, while other markets fall well below the national average. | State | Cities | Entry (P10) | Median | Senior (P90)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| California | 61 | $51,583 | $71,642 | $101,732 |
| Massachusetts | 4 | $49,848 | $69,233 | $98,310 |
| Hawaii | 1 | $49,572 | $68,850 | $97,767 |
| District of Columbia | 1 | $45,900 | $63,750 | $90,525 |
| New Jersey | 4 | $45,349 | $62,985 | $89,439 |
| Washington | 8 | $44,477 | $61,774 | $87,719 |
| New York | 5 | $41,861 | $58,140 | $82,559 |
| Rhode Island | 1 | $41,861 | $58,140 | $82,559 |
| Florida | 22 | $41,544 | $57,700 | $81,933 |
| Colorado | 11 | $40,826 | $56,703 | $80,518 |
| New Hampshire | 1 | $40,759 | $56,610 | $80,386 |
| Nevada | 5 | $40,686 | $56,508 | $80,241 |
| Arizona | 12 | $40,484 | $56,228 | $79,843 |
| Oregon | 5 | $40,392 | $56,100 | $79,662 |
| Idaho | 3 | $40,270 | $55,930 | $79,421 |
| Connecticut | 5 | $39,951 | $55,488 | $78,793 |
| Utah | 4 | $39,841 | $55,335 | $78,576 |
| Virginia | 7 | $39,185 | $54,424 | $77,282 |
| South Carolina | 3 | $38,678 | $53,720 | $76,282 |
| Alaska | 1 | $38,556 | $53,550 | $76,041 |
| Illinois | 5 | $38,115 | $52,938 | $75,172 |
| North Carolina | 9 | $37,169 | $51,623 | $73,305 |
| New Mexico | 3 | $36,720 | $51,000 | $72,420 |
| Montana | 1 | $36,720 | $51,000 | $72,420 |
| Tennessee | 6 | $36,598 | $50,830 | $72,179 |
| Texas | 40 | $36,417 | $50,579 | $71,823 |
| Minnesota | 2 | $36,353 | $50,490 | $71,696 |
| Wisconsin | 2 | $36,169 | $50,235 | $71,334 |
| Georgia | 6 | $36,047 | $50,065 | $71,092 |
| Pennsylvania | 3 | $35,986 | $49,980 | $70,972 |
| Kansas | 4 | $35,802 | $49,725 | $70,610 |
| Michigan | 6 | $35,680 | $49,555 | $70,368 |
| Kentucky | 2 | $35,252 | $48,960 | $69,524 |
| Maryland | 1 | $35,251 | $48,960 | $69,523 |
| Nebraska | 2 | $34,884 | $48,450 | $68,799 |
| South Dakota | 1 | $34,884 | $48,450 | $68,799 |
| Oklahoma | 4 | $33,966 | $47,175 | $66,989 |
| North Dakota | 1 | $33,782 | $46,920 | $66,626 |
| Louisiana | 4 | $33,323 | $46,283 | $65,721 |
| Missouri | 4 | $33,324 | $46,283 | $65,721 |
| Alabama | 5 | $33,195 | $46,104 | $65,468 |
| Indiana | 3 | $32,681 | $45,390 | $64,454 |
| Arkansas | 1 | $32,681 | $45,390 | $64,454 |
| Iowa | 2 | $32,314 | $44,880 | $63,730 |
| Ohio | 6 | $32,253 | $44,795 | $63,609 |
| Mississippi | 1 | $30,845 | $42,840 | $60,833 |
The state salary map for Legal Assistants: California at $71,642, Massachusetts at $69,233, Hawaii at $68,850 lead the pack. The bottom tier — Mississippi ($42,840), Ohio ($44,795), Iowa ($44,880) — shows how regional economics reshape compensation. Across all 46 states with data, the state-level spread alone is $28,802.

All salary data on this page is sourced from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(OEWS) program, which surveys employers across U.S. metropolitan areas. We present 10th percentile (entry), 50th percentile (median), and 90th percentile (senior) pay benchmarks. Cost-of-living adjustments use our core database of 288 cities.
Salary data is sourced from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(OEWS) program, which surveys employers across U.S. metropolitan and non-metropolitan areas. We present the 10th percentile (entry-level), 50th percentile (median), and 90th percentile (senior) pay benchmarks.
Cost-of-living adjustments use Livably's core index derived from Zillow rent data, Census income surveys, and regional BLS price data. Take-home pay estimates apply simplified federal brackets, 7.65% FICA, and state income tax rates from the Tax Foundation.
State and national averages are computed as simple means across all tracked cities with data for this occupation. Rankings are updated monthly as new BLS releases become available.
